  • Patent number: 11844277
    Abstract: A vibrating actuator includes a contact body and a vibrating body that vibrates, has an energy conversion element, and has an elastic body in contact with the contact body to move relative to each other from the vibration. The contact body has a base part, a thin plate part, a support part, and a friction member. The thin plate part extends from the base part toward an annular center axis of the base part and the support part is disposed at an end of the thin plate part. The friction member is disposed to the support part as a member separate from the support part and in contact with the elastic body. Density of the friction member is higher than density of the thin plate part. A weight ratio of the thin plate part to a total weight of the friction member and the support part is 0.5 to 1.5.

  • Publication number: 20230391674
    Abstract: A sintered body comprises zirconia including a stabilizer element dissolved therein and a lanthanoid element dissolved therein, the lanthanoid element having an ionic radius larger than the atomic radius of zirconium. The content of monoclinic zirconia after a hydrothermal treatment at 140° C. for 24 hours is less than 25%. The sintered body includes a spinel compound including aluminum and a coloring element.

  • Patent number: 11689121
    Abstract: There is provided a vibration wave motor that includes a plurality of pressing parts separated by slits and can prevent an intervention member from protruding from the slits. The vibration wave motor includes a vibrator, a driven body configured to be brought into pressure contact with the vibrator and to move relative to the vibrator, a pressing member configured to move together with the driven body and to bring the driven body into pressure contact with the vibrator, and an intervention member intervening between the driven body and the pressing member, and configured to be pressed together with the driven body when the pressing member brings the driven body into pressure contact with the vibrator. The pressing member includes a plurality of pressing parts that is separated by slits and presses the intervention member. The intervention member is firmly fixed to the driven body.

  • Patent number: 11658587
    Abstract: A vibration actuator includes a vibrating body and a contact body having an annular shape. The vibrating body vibrates and includes an annular elastic body and an electro-mechanical energy conversion element. The contact body is in contact with the vibrating body and moves relative to the vibrating body. The contact body includes a base portion, a supporting portion annularly extending from the base portion in a radial direction of the annular shape of contact body, and a friction member that is on the supporting portion, is different in member from the supporting portion, and is in contact with the vibrating body. A first gap is between one end of the friction member and the supporting portion, and a second gap is between the one end of the friction member and the vibrating body.
